Chapter Five
Daniel turned back towards the room in front of him and scanned it again. This time taking in all the small details he'd skimmed over earlier. At first, his gaze found items he'd expect to see in Jack's bathroom.
A can of shaving foam standing on the sink underneath the mirror. Razor precariously thrown down next to it. Bar of soap. Toothpaste squeezed from the middle – god, that was annoying – toothbrush…
Then his mind began to pick up on the items which were definitely out of place in a single male's bathroom.
Extra toothbrush sitting at the side of the previously mentioned one. Except instead of plain blue, this one was pale yellow with a daisy pattern adorning it. Daniel looked closer. There was another razor. Placed neatly out of the way on the right-hand side of the sink. Except this one was pink. As was the zipped cosmetics bag next to it.
He turned his attention to the bathtub. Bubble bath, honey shampoo, a strange poofy item that even his powers of observation had trouble identifying. He assumed it to be to be some sort of hi-tech sponge but he wasn't sure that he wanted to know if it wasn't…and he was going nowhere near trying to figure out what that odd red glittery ball was for.
Wait. Was that a rubber duck in the corner? Yes, yes it was. Even more disturbing was the fact that it was covered in camouflage patterning.
Oh…my.
Finished with his perusal and he had to admit, slightly disturbed by it, Daniel turned back to Jack. He had an idea where this was heading. Jack met his gaze levelly, before turning without saying a word and walking back into the bedroom.
Daniel watched as he strolled over to the closet in the corner and flung the doors wide. Stepping to one side, Jack once again indicated that Daniel should take a look. This time knowing what he was supposed to seeing, Daniel skimmed his gaze quickly over the uniform, sweaters, hockey shirts and pants. His eyes sought out and found a pale blue dress, several skirts and a rather feminine-looking sweater, before dropping downwards and finally alighting on a pair of high-heeled sandals that he was fairly certain did not belong to Jack.
Jack stepped forward and spread his arms wide in the direction of the closet.
"Ya see?"
Daniel coughed and crossed his arms over chest.
"I'm going to assume you're attempting to point out everything here which belongs to Sam, rather than trying to tell me that you like to dress up as 'Jacqueline' in your spare time..."
Jack scowled.
"You're not funny, Daniel."
Daniel smirked.
"Really? I thought I was pretty good myself…"
Jack glared, but disappointingly for Daniel, he didn't rise to the bait. Instead he sighed and ran a hand through his hair.
"But yeah, all this stuff…is Sam's. And that's without even mentioning all the faffy food which has made it's way into the cupboards! I mean, bulghar wheat? Who the hell eats that?"
Jack shook his head in a visible effort to stay on track.
"Anyway… Point is Daniel, she's already moved in! Yeah okay, so she's not here that often, but when she is - "
He shrugged, as if the answer was obvious. Which perhaps it was…to Jack.
" - it's as much her place as it is mine."
"Maybe she just needs to be told that?"
Jack's expression said loud and clear that he honestly didn't understand why Sam would need to be told. It was her stuff after all, shouldn't she just know?
Unfortunately, Daniel didn't have an answer for him. Possibly because Jack wasn't the only one didn't understand it.
Daniel shrugged.
"Maybe it's a woman thing."
The glare was back.
"That doesn't help me, Daniel."
Yeah, he'd figured as much. But there was just so much entertainment value to be had in poking fun at a frustrated Jack O'Neill.
"Right." Jack said eventually, giving a heavy sigh.
"Thank you, Daniel. You've been a great help."
The tone of his voice told Daniel that he didn't believe that anymore than Daniel did.
Daniel fought hard to keep from laughing out loud.
"You're welcome."
He paused for effect.
"That'll be three hundred dollars, Jack."
Then he turned on his heel and ran.
-fini-
